At Southwestern Assemblies of God University (SAGU), Robert Herrera has been named the new Head Cross Country Coach. Robert Herrera finished his first season serving as SAGU's assistant track and field coach. Herrera, a former standout student-athlete at SAGU, is a steadfast and well-known figure at SAGU and has shown the ability to motivate a team of players to strive toward a common goal.
"I am extremely excited, humbled, honored, and eager to step into the role of the Head Cross-Country Coach at SAGU. This is a program that I have found success with as an athlete and assistant coach. However, this is a new year that requires new goals and expectations needing to be met. I'm starting a new journey at this amazing university and am thankful for SAGU's belief in me to achieve what I love doing. I am focused on equipping our individuals to be running billboards for Christ. And eager to make our mark once again in the NAIA. I look forward to working with the men & women of this program and helping them achieve their dreams," said Robert Herrera.
"Robert Herrera was a successful student-athlete at SAGU in cross-country. He possesses the technical knowledge, relationship-building ability, and administrative capacity to flourish as a head coach. Most importantly, SAGU has the opportunity to hire a SAGU alum who cares deeply for the institution, lives out the organization's mission and values, and as an assistant coach, has demonstrated deep care and concern for those individuals in his care. I am certain he will make a lasting impact on our cross-country program," remarked SAGU Director of Athletics, Dr. Jesse Godding.
